Here is what part-time students pay per credit hour at West Virginia University at Parkersburg, plus the regular full-year tuition and fees for context.

Part-time undergraduates from in state pay $224 a credit hour. For out-of-state students the figure is $389 a credit hour.
| In-State | Out-of-State | |
|---|---|---|
| Cost Per Credit Hour | $224 | $389 |
Remember that this per-credit-hour figure is before any grant aid or scholarships that could lower the cost.
To put the per-credit-hour rate in context, full-time annual tuition and fees at West Virginia University at Parkersburg follow below.
Required fees account for came to $100 in-state and $100 out-of-state; the rest is tuition itself.
| In-State | Out-of-State | |
|---|---|---|
| Tuition | $4,512 | $9,024 |
| Fees | $100 | $100 |
| Total | $4,612 | $9,124 |
The totals above are for instruction and do not cover housing and meals.
This is how tuition at West Virginia University at Parkersburg has moved over the last few reported years.
| Year | In-State Tuition | Out-of-State Tuition |
|---|---|---|
| Three Years Ago | $3,740 | $8,092 |
| Two Years Ago | $4,032 | $9,024 |
| One Year Ago | $4,320 | $9,024 |
| Most Recent Year | $4,512 | $9,024 |
Annual tuition increases are the norm at most institutions, so the figure you see today is unlikely to be the figure you pay across all four years.
When you map out how you’ll pay for college, build in expected annual increases so the later years don’t catch you off guard.
